Overview of the Project
The pavement improvement project stands as a testament to the government’s commitment to infrastructural development. As noted by DPWH Regional Office IX Director Cayamombao Dia, the project involves preventive maintenance works through asphalt overlay along a two-lane, 6.8-kilometer stretch of the Imelda-Payao-Siay Road. This road gracefully traverses through Barangays Guintolan and San Isidro, connecting rural communities with urban centers. Notably, the intervention aligns with a broader vision set forth by President Ferdinand R. Marcos, Jr. to enhance the national road network across the Philippines.

Safety Features
Safety is a fundamental aspect of any road improvement endeavor. The P95.5 million project implemented by the DPWH Zamboanga Sibugay 1st District Engineering Office includes the installation of reflectorized thermoplastic pavement markings. These markings serve as vital safety features, enhancing visibility for motorists, particularly during nighttime travel. Moreover, improved road conditions significantly reduce the likelihood of accidents, promoting a safer environment for all road users.
